In this step by step tutorial Matt from the Underground Cookery School shows you how to cook his favourite Chinese dish, the all time classic, chicken chow mein. Ingredients

  • 1 cups (250ml) chicken strips
  • 1 soy sauce
  • 1 tsp chinese five spice
  • Tabasco
  • 1/2 tsp cornflour
  • vegetable oil
  • 1 red pepper, cut into strips
  • cooked noodles
  • 1 cups (250ml) bean sprouts
  • 1 spring onions, chopped
  • sesame oil

Method

Place your chicken strips, soy sauce, five spice, corn flour and a few shakes of Tabasco sauce into a bowl. Mix all the ingredients well.

Add some vegetable oil to a wok and heat it until very hot. Fry your chicken for about 3-4 minutes stirring the whole time.

Add your red pepper and cook for another minute, then add the bean sprouts and spring onions.

Add some cooked noodles which have been tossed in sesame oil. cook for a further 30 seconds until the noodles are heated through, then serve.
